Forklift tyres have pneumatic and solid tyres. Tire inflation pressure must be in accordance with the original factory standards, not too high or too low. Over-high tire elasticity decreases and the line layer is easy to break. Low air pressure can cause severe deformation of tire, increase temperature, cause degumming or fracture, and may also cause the outer tire to move on the rim and wear the tire ring. In serious cases, the inner tire valve mouth will be torn.
